Lady Dynamite
Netflix has a new comedy series starring Maria Bamford and executive produced by Bamford, Mitch Hurwitz and Pam Brady. Lady Dynamite is based on what Bamford has accepted to be “her life.” The occasionally surreal episodes, refracted across multiple periods inspired by the actor/comedian’s life, tell the story of a woman who loses – and then finds – her s**t. All episodes premiere May 20 on Netflix.
No Men Beyond This Point
In this mockumentary, women rule the world and are no longer giving birth to males. A quiet, unassuming housekeeper named Andrew Myers finds himself at the center of a battle to keep men from going extinct.
The Magnificent Seven
Desperate townspeople hire seven mercenaries (Denzel Washington, Chris Pratt, Ethan Hawke) to battle a ruthless industrialist in the Old West.
I loved the original 1960 version with Yul Brynner, Steve McQueen, and Charles Bronson. This trailer seems to inject more humor but also more explosions and action.
Release date: September 23, 2016
Jason Bourne
Matt Damon returns to his most iconic role in Jason Bourne. Damon is joined by Alicia Vikander, Vincent Cassel and Tommy Lee Jones, and Julia Stiles.
While little is known about the plot of the movie we do know that it has been 9 years since the Bourne Ultimatum. What has Jason Bourne been up to now that he remembers everything?
Find out July 29th, 2016.
